The Behavioral Technician will provide clinical skills instruction and behavior reduction protocols based upon the principles of Applied Behavior Analysis. Clients include children with Autism and related developmental disabilities in the home, community, clinic, and school settings. The Behavioral Technician will collect data on programs and assist with parent training. The Behavior Technician works under the supervision of a Board-Certified Behavior Analyst.

The principles of behavior analysis are to treat patients who have difficulties with socially significant behaviors. These may include social skills, reading, communication, personal self-care and work skills.

Essential Job Functions / Responsibilities

  • Plans and implements intervention strategies using direct therapy, monitoring and consultation under the supervision of a BCBA.
  • Teaches targeted behaviors using specialized techniques that may include reward systems, incidental teaching and pivotal response training.
  • Records and tracks data from training sessions.
  • Reinforces positive behavior with children on caseload.
  • Communicates effectively (orally and in writing) with administrators, parents and community members.
  • Provides accurate documentation of intervention, goals and objectives
  • Facilitates transition among agencies, programs, and professionals as service provision changes (early intervention to pre-school, pre-school to school etc.)
  • Identifies emergency situations and determines appropriate action to ensure child safety.
  • Provide direct client care in 1 : 1 and group settings utilizing a combination of intensive teaching and natural environment training arrangements.
  • Follow the prescribed behavior skill acquisition and behavior reduction protocols.
  • Collect, record, and summarize data on observable client behavior
  • Assist with parent and caregiver training in line with client's individualized treatment and behavior reduction protocols.
  • Effectively communicate with parents and caregivers regarding client progress as instructed by the Board Certified Behavior Analyst
  • Will perform other duties as assigned.

    Qualifications

    Position Qualifications

  • A bachelor's degree in a human services field from an accredited university AND one year of direct relevant experience working with youth and families who require behavior management to address mental health needs
  • OR

  • An associate's degree (60 college credits) AND a minimum of two years of direct relevant experience working with youth and families who require behavior management to address mental health needs.
  • Strong organization and communication skills are required.
  • Registered Behavior technician certification is a plus.
